It can be quite difficult for a tester to find all bugs in a certain program and solve them. Teams spend a lot of time doing their best to detect every error that decreases the functionality of a product. As such, they need something that makes the entire testing process much easier and more effective, such as a bug management tool.
There are various types of bug management programs, and by doing proper research, you can find the right one for you. How can defect management tools optimize testing efforts, though? Here’s everything you need to know.
What Are Bug Management Tools?
A bug management tool is a type of program that makes it easier for testers to manage software defects. There are many reasons why bugs occur and they’re usually caused by human error, malfunctioning third-party apps, coding mistakes, and so on.
With the right tool, you can test the software before it gets released, find bugs, and work to fix them so that you can improve user experience.
What Are the Benefits of a Bug Management Tool?
All defect management tools come with various advantages to make a tester’s life easier and lead to well-crafted software. Here are a few of the benefits that a bug management tool can provide:
Finding Improvement Areas
With the right tool, you will be able to find software areas that could use some improvement. For example, there may be parts of a particular program or system that are more vulnerable to defects and errors. With a good app, you can take care of these areas and improve them before they will require additional work.
Proper Bug Testing
Once defects are tracked, they need to be fixed. But that doesn’t mean that you can just move on with your life after creating the hotfix – a bug must still be tested continuously. This can be done with defect management tools. In the end, regular testing will help you figure out if a hotfix is enough to solve an issue.
Improving the Quality of the Product
A bug management app will allow you to properly detect bugs in software. Then, by reporting defects, testing them, and fixing them, you can improve the quality of the program you’re working on. Also, your tool can ensure that every single bug has been resolved after being identified.
Trend Analysis
As you keep tracking bugs, you will start to notice patterns. This can turn out to be very useful in the future. It will allow you to build a history of bug tracking and solutions, and this will make it easier to fix similar issues in the future. Not only will you be able to find problem areas, but you’ll also be able to look at what you did in the past and use the same techniques to fix defects. This can also save time.
Final Thoughts
Not having a proper bug management tool to rely on can make your work as a tester much harder. Search for a good tool and this way, you can streamline the bug-tracking and management process.